Congressional Republicans Introduce National Right-to-Work Bill

Congressional Republicans reintroduced an act Wednesday that would allow employees to opt out of labor union membership.

The National Labor Relations Board 2020 Year In Review – An Overview of Major Developments in Labor Law | McNees Wallace & Nurick LLC

Introduction In our last Review, we reported that the National Labor Relations Board had a very busy year.  Despite the challenges of the COVID-19 pandemic, 2020 was also a fairly busy year for the Board.  In its final year, the Trump Board produced a number of key decisions for employers.  Whether those decision stand the test of time remains to be seen, because the Biden Board will soon begin its work.  In the meantime, we will review the highlights from 2020 and preview some of the possible changes that may be down the road. To embed, copy and paste the code into your website or blog: American Rescue Plan Moves Forward. Democrats in Congress are moving ahead with President Joe Biden’s “American Rescue Plan.” As of now—and this is still subject to change, of course—it appears that the U.S. House of Representatives’ budget and rules committees will both weigh in on the legislation early next week before sending the bill to the House floor toward the end of the week.
